NATURALLY GLAMOROUS<br />
“The year 1918 meets the year <strong>2018</strong>”<br />
in Joan Marie by The Leland Group,<br />
with rustic and glamorous elements<br />
mingling for a dramatic effect. To<br />
heighten the intrigue, designer Katie<br />
Linich of Creative Environments by<br />
Carol & Katie used jewel tones alongside<br />
natural elements like wide-plank<br />
flooring and Indiana limestone.<br />
Cape Verde, from Sherwin-Williams,<br />
“is a beautiful, rich emerald color that<br />
is used to pick up the color from the<br />
living plants scattered throughout the<br />
house,” Linich says, adding that the<br />
shade looks gorgeous alongside brass<br />
and polished nickel.<br />
Bosporus is “a beautiful sapphire<br />
color that plays nicely with Cape<br />
Verde,” she says. Look for it in surprising<br />
places, like a bathroom ceiling<br />
and on closet doors.<br />

EYES ON THE ARCHITECTURE<br />
“Southern living with farmhouse<br />
touches” is the way Jill Koch and<br />
Julia Bender of Designs on Madison<br />
describe The Ashby Manor by<br />
Wieland Builders. To keep the focus<br />
on the home’s charming architectural<br />
details—like rustic ceiling beams and<br />
a stone wall in the great room—they<br />
opted for a neutral color scheme,<br />
using Anew Gray in the main living<br />
area. “It’s a soft color that pulls gray<br />
and beige, letting the beams ‘sing’ in<br />
the space,” Koch explains.<br />
